CIBAC REP. VILLANUEVA TO BOOST FIGHT VS CORRUPTION

Citizens’ Battle Against Corruption (CIBAC) Party-list Representative Bro. Eddie Villanueva took his oath of office recently, as he vowed to intensify his fight against corruption in the government. Villanueva was sworn into office by Supreme Court Chief Justice Alexander Gesmundo, and was accompanied by his son, reelected Senator Joel Villanueva at the Supreme Court Complex […]

BENGUET DEV’T BODY GETS SENATE OK – TOLENTINO

A bill seeking to create a development authority embracing Baguio City, La Trinidad, Itogon, Sablan, Tuba, and Tublay in Benguet province received unanimous support from senators who voted 18-0-0 to pass it on the third and final reading. House Bill No. 9215 sponsored by the chairman of the Committee on Local Government, Senator Francis Tolentino, […]
